Output e65e6ff6088831eb88d587b996b843f7a540f0dc72dfa5c02a74bd307aa37d2b:3

value
42348226571
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fdd1224685860df1ceeff1189046d5600c4d2d1 OP_EQUALVERIFY OP_CHECKSIG
address
DRYn4JvUqk3x9M7iDPfx2nWuanwKWoddbm
transaction
e65e6ff6088831eb88d587b996b843f7a540f0dc72dfa5c02a74bd307aa37d2b